The Shocking Truth About Winning Wrongful Death Cases in New Mexico is straightforward. These cases require proof that negligence caused fatal harm. Families must show duty, breach, causation, and measurable losses.

  • How long do families typically have to file in New Mexico?

New Mexico usually gives two years from the date of death to start a lawsuit.

  • What makes evidence strong in these cases?

Official records, photos, videos, and expert testimony help prove negligence caused the death.
